Boulidou de Roubiac
Boulidou de Roubiac is a cave in Cazevieille, Arrondissement of Lodève, Occitanie. Boulidou de Roubiac is situated nearby to the archaeological site Dolmen dit Grand Juyan de Roubiac, as well as near the cave Grotte de Roubiac.| Tap on a place to explore it |

Pic Saint-Loup
Peak
Photo: Kevin91, CC BY-SA 3.0.
Pic Saint-Loup is a mountain in Languedoc-Roussillon, southern France, located near the communes of Cazevieille and Saint-Mathieu-de-Tréviers in the Hérault department. Pic Saint-Loup is situated 3½ km northeast of Boulidou de Roubiac.

Saint-Gély-du-Fesc
Town
Photo: Wikimedia, CC BY-SA 4.0.
Saint-Gély-du-Fesc is a commune in the department of Hérault, Occitania, southern France. The origin of this city is from Saint Gilles, a Christian of the 8th century, and Fesc means « control post » in Occitan language. Saint-Gély-du-Fesc is situated 7 km south of Boulidou de Roubiac.
